- Abstract
- Laser fuze has advantages of anti electromagnetic interference and high accuracy of measuring distance, will become an important development direction of future fuze. This paper constructs the hardware-in-the-loop simulation system of pulsed laser fuze. Solved laser echo characteristic parameters of different encounter conditions based on the research of the environmental factors, target characteristics and the missile target encounter conditions etc. And take the characteristic parameters as the simulation parameters of laser echo. With the help of the echo signal simulator to simulate the processing of missile target encounter. The echo signal calibration system is used to calibrate the output laser power of the echo signal simulator. The experimental results show that: under the condition of laboratory, the system can realize the accurate simulation of the laser echo signal as well as has a certain reference value for the design of laser fuze.
